u/A_Shifty_Peacock 2d ago
Only brand to stay away from is a bootleg brand called BT Building blocks, they're a nightmare to build because the manufacturing tolerances are worse so none of the parts fit together right without sanding and gluing everything.
The 2 official brands that build modern Zoids - Kotobukiya who make the 1/72 scale Highend Master Models (HMM) and Tomy T Spark who make the 1/72 scale Advanced Zi (AZ) and 1/100 scale Realize Model Zoids (RMZ) - are both good, and HMM, AZ and RMZ all have their individual strengths and weaknesses.
If you're new to model kit making I'd definitely recommend starting with RMZ, they're the cheapest, sturdiest and most beginner friendly, and they're also just great little kits.
From there if you enjoyed the experience you have the choice of sticking with RMZ kits, trying AZ kits which are bigger, more complex and also motorized, or trying HMM kits which are the most detailed but also the least beginner friendly (500-600 pieces vs the 100-150 pieces for RMZ and AZ).

u/chain_letter 2d ago
Try a cheap HG gundam or easier zoids realize before diving into a zoids HMM, that way if you find out you don’t like it, you’ll be close to finished when you learn instead of having hours left to go
You’ll need nippers, other cutters make it a not fun process. And household super glue is fine for beginner cheaper builds, on the rare chance it’s called for.

u/one_love_silvia 2d ago
Repackaged for zoids means the model has been redesigned with fixes for some prior issues like loose joints or whatnot.
